We built our fire pit on the lawn from regular retaining wall blocks lined with clay fire bricks, but you can also build your pit on a cement or stone patio. Rectangular blocks make it easy to adjust the layout to a size that works well for your design.

November 1, 2024 - When installing a fire pit in your yard, use a stake and put it in what will be the centre of your pit. Use marking paint tied to a string to draw a circle around the stake. This will give you the overall shape of your pit and allow you to build it by “tracing” the line with your blocks.
